Write out the contents of the temp field to a text file on the server
then add that file to the attachment field.

I have a really strange request to make but it is a bit of a strange
situation. Is there a way to take a large amount of data from a character
field and save it as an attachment as a text file?
User sends a template email request with an oversized description. The
template puts this information into an unlimited temp field. A filter takes
the first 1,000 characters and places it in the Description field and then
places the entire temp field contents onto a diary field. What I would like
to do is take the temp field contents and put them into a text file and
attach the file to the ticket. Any ideas on how to do that?
ARS 6.3 patch 20, Oracle 9.2, SunOS 5.9
